3664

32-Point Dual 24 VDC Digital Output Module

Product Describe:

Triconex 3664 is a thirty-two-point dual 24 VDC digital output module. It produces voted source outputs and supervises field-voltage agreement for safety-related control duties.

Technical specifications for 3664

Technical specifications for 3664

  • Manufacturer:
    Invensys
  • Product Category:
    DCS System
  • Spare Part Number:
    3664
  • Estimated shipping dimensions:
    49x45.3x6.8cm
  • Weight:
    3.25 kg
  • Tariff Code:
    8537101190
  • Counliy of origin:
    USA
  • Module type:
    Dual serial digital output
  • Nominal voltage:
    24 VDC
  • Output signals:
    32 commoned
  • Voltage range:
    16 to 30 VDC
  • Maximum voltage:
    36 VDC
  • Typical voltage drop:
    <1.5 VDC
  • Power-module load:
    <10 W
  • Maximum point current:
    2 A
  • Surge current:
    10 A for 10 ms
  • Load leakage:
    2 mA maximum
  • Output protection:
    Self-protecting; no field-termination fuses
  • Point isolation:
    1500 VDC minimum
  • Status indicators:
    1 per point; PASS; FAULT; ACTIVE; LOAD/FUSE
  • Color code:
    Dark blue
  • Compatible commoned panel:
    9662-610
  • Compatible basic panel:
    9653-610
  • Compatible nonincendive panel:
    9671-610
  • Compatible ERT loop-back:
    9671-810

Triconex 3664 is a thirty-two-point dual 24 VDC digital output module. It produces voted source outputs and supervises field-voltage agreement for safety-related control duties.
  • Applies two-out-of-three voting to each of thirty-two output switches
  • Sources 24 VDC current to commoned field loads through dual output circuitry
  • Uses voltage loopback to compare commanded state with detected field voltage
  • Supports online hot-spare replacement with continuous channel diagnostics

3664 installs with Tricon I/O chassis and hot-spare position, 9662-610 or compatible termination panel, 16-30 VDC field supply, solenoids, relays, or other protected DC loads in an engineered Tricon dual digital output configuration.

Read the applicable Triconex installation instructions before work. Verify 3664 and the installed Tricon dual digital output configuration.
1Verify 3664 and the de-energize-to-trip application before module replacement.
2Place all commanded equipment in the approved safe state and isolate field power.
3Record thirty-two channel assignments, common supply, and expected de-energized states.
4Confirm each load stays within the two-amp point and ten-amp surge limits.
5Use a listed termination panel and preserve the sourced-output wiring arrangement.
6Use ESD controls and check module keying plus the hot-spare position.
7Command outputs individually and compare field voltage with LOAD/FUSE indication.
8Test hot-spare transfer and the final shutdown function before production release.

Technical notes

Technical notes

Wire field power to every used output through the approved panel, confirm per-point and surge loading, and exercise loopback plus LOAD/FUSE diagnostics before enabling safety commands.
